Paycom Software (PAYC) raised its annual revenue outlook on Wednesday, driven by steady demand for AI-driven employee management services. The update underscores ongoing growth in AI-enabled payroll and HR offerings and may support multiple expansion if profitability remains favorable. Investors will scrutinize any disclosed revenue and margin specifics to assess sustainability.
